Softball Preview: Hughesville Spartans vs. Bloomsburg Panthers
The Hughesville Spartans will face off against the Bloomsburg Panthers at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. The timing is sure in Hughesville's favor as the squad sits on six straight wins at home while Bloomsburg has been banged up by six consecutive losses on the road.
Hughesville's pitching crew heads into the matchup hoping to repeat the dominance they displayed on Tuesday. They were the clear victors by a 12-0 margin over Southern Columbia Area. The Spartans might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won five games by six runs or more this season.
Adelyn Knight was a standout: she went 3-for-4 with three runs, one triple, and one RBI. The team also got some help courtesy of Maddie Smith, who went a perfect 1-for-1 with two stolen bases, three RBI, and two runs.
Hughesville was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.435. That was just more of the same: they've now posted a batting average of .323 or higher in four consecutive contests.
Meanwhile, it was a proper cat-fight when Bloomsburg duked it out with Southern Columbia Area on Monday. The Panthers came up short against the Tigers, falling 10-4.
Mya Coyne made the most of her time at bat despite the final result and went 2-for-4 with two stolen bases, two doubles, and one run. Kara Bodganowicz was another key player, going 2-for-4 with one home run and two RBI.
Bloomsburg's defeat dropped their record down to 2-11. As for Hughesville, their victory bumped their record up to 10-4.
The pitchers for both teams better look sharp on Thursday as neither team is afraid to steal. Hughesville has been swiping bases left and right this season, having averaged 3 stolen bases per game. However, it's not like Bloomsburg struggles in that department as they've been averaging 4.8 stolen bases. The only question left is which team can snag more.
Hughesville took their win against Bloomsburg in their previous meeting on Friday by a conclusive 19-1 score. Will the Spartans repeat their success, or do the Panthers have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
